Not to be taken too seriously.

Trade 6 for a mid 1 and mid 2.

Tag and trade TJ for a mid 1.

1a. James Laurinaitis - starting MLB for the next 10 years.
1b. Beanie Wells - gives us the stud RB we haven't had since a young Corey Dillon
2a. Mike Mickens - Nickel CB and depth considering JoJo's injury history.
2b. (from trade down) Connor Barwin - Add to our pass rush, and put on the kick block teams.
3. Marcus Freeman - SAM LB with a lot of athleticism and room to improve under FitzGerald.
4a. Alex Boone - Starting RT.
4b. (comp) Trevor Canfield - Move Bobbie to center and Canfield to RG.
5. Kevin Huber - Bye bye Larson, hello best punter in the NCAA!
6. Terill Byrd - Adds depth at DT
7a. Brandon Underwood - Depth and competition at safety, can also play corner and teams.
7b. (comp) Steve Rehring - a big body that can add deptha at guard or tackle.
CFA - Todd Boeckman - big, strong, good deep ball, groomed to be eventual #2 QB.

Here's a team of eligible college players that are from or play in Ohio:

QB - Nate Davis, Ball State - from Bellaire, Ohio
RB - Chris Wells, Ohio State
FB - Eric Kettani, Navy - from Kirtland, Ohio
WR - Marshawn Gilyard, Cincinnati
WR - Brian Robiskie, Ohio State
TE - Rory Nicol, Ohio State
LT - Augustus Parrish, Kent State
LG - Trevor Canfield, Cincinnati
C - Eric Wood, Louisville - from Cincy
RG - Steve Rehring, Ohio State
RT - Alex Boone, Ohio State

DE - Connor Barwin, Cincinnati
DT - Nader Abdallah, Ohio State
DT - Terrill Byrd, Cincinnati
DE - Lawrence Wilson, Ohio State
WLB - Marcus Freeman, Ohio State
MLB - James Laurinaits, Ohio State
SLB - Thaddeus Gibson, Ohio State
CB - Malcom Jenkins, Ohio State
CB - Mike Mickens, Cincinnati
FS - David Bruton, Notre Dame - from Miamisburg
SS - Kurt Coleman, Ohio State
